Impact Of Macroeconomic Factors On Financial Performance Of Deposit-Taking Micro Finance Institutions In Kenya

ABSTRACT

The study focused on the impact of macroeconomic variables on financial

performance of deposit taking microfinance institutions in Kenya. The specific

objectives were to assess the impact of inflation on the financial performance of

deposit taking microfinance institutions in Kenya, to ascertain the influence of gross

domestic product growth rate on the financial performance of deposit taking MFIs in

Kenya, to examine the relationship between exchange rate and financial performance

of deposit taking MFIs in Kenya, to determine the impact of national saving rate on

the financial performance of deposit taking MFIs and to find out the impact of

employment rate on the financial performance of deposit taking MFIs in Kenya. The

target population of the study was all the nine (9) deposit taking microfinance

institutions in Kenya registered with the central bank of Kenya (2014). Secondary

data was collected on all the microfinance institutions financial data from the Central

Bank of Kenya periodicals, macroeconomic data was collected from the National

bureau of statistics and the central bank of Kenya for a period of ten years between

2005 and 2014. Data was analyzed using a multiple regression analysis model using

SPSS version 20.0 as the data analysis tool. The findings of this study are; there is a

negative relationship between inflation rate and financial performance of deposittaking

micro finance institutions in all the years studied. This means that an increase

in inflation coursed a decrease in financial performance of deposit-taking micro

finance institutions in all the years studied. There was a positive relationship between

gross domestic product and financial performance of deposit-taking micro finance

institutions in all the years studied. This means that an increase in gross domestic

product coursed an increase in financial performance of deposit-taking micro finance

institutions in all the years studied. There was a positive relationship between

exchange rate and financial performance of deposit-taking micro finance institutions

in all the years studied. This means that an increase in exchange rate coursed an

increase in financial performance of deposit-taking micro finance institutions in all

the years studied, there was a positive relationship between national savings rate and

financial performance of deposit-taking micro finance institutions in all the years

studied. This means that an increase in inflation coursed an increase in financial

performance of deposit-taking micro finance institutions in all the years considered.

There was a positive relationship between employment rate and financial performance

of deposit-taking micro finance institutions in all the years studied. This means that an

increase in employment rate coursed an increase in financial performance of deposittaking

micro finance institutions in all the years studied. The recommendations of the

study are; The Government should closely monitor and prudently manage the

macroeconomic variable in order to spur greater financial performance as they explain

a higher variation in financial performance of the deposit taking microfinance

institutions in Kenya. The government should also control Inflation since it has an

adverse impact on the financial performance of deposit taking microfinance

institutions in Kenya. Lastly the government should strive to improve the country’s

GDP, National savings and employment rate as they positively affect the financial

performance.
